Mid Europa Partners, a private equity investor focussed on Central and Eastern Europe, has completed the acquisition of Urgent Cargus.   Urgent Cargus is a courier, express and parcel service provider in Romania, offering last mile delivery to over 85,000 customers, including business clients, e-commerce retailers and private individuals.   Urgent Cargus operates a dense network of five hubs and 71 stations connected by 360 linehaul routes, which together with its state-of-the-art asset base and logistical capabilities enable the Company to offer high-quality services such as 24-hour delivery across the country.

Zip World, an award-winning outdoor adventure business which features the world’s fastest zipline, has secured a significant minority investment from mid-market private equity investor LDC, supported by the company’s existing banking partner, HSBC. The deal values the business at GBP45 million. The business runs adventure experiences across three scenic locations in the iconic Snowdonia mountain range in North Wales. SVB Financial Group (SVB), the parent company of Silicon Valley Bank, has completed the acquisition of Leerink Holdings LLC, a Boston-based parent company of healthcare and life science investment bank Leerink Partners. Leerink will operate under the name SVB Leerink as a wholly-owned subsidiary of SVB Financial Group, led by Jeff Leerink, CEO of SVB Leerink; James Boylan, President and Head of Investment Banking; and Joe Gentile, Chief Administrative Officer. Private equity firm TA Associates has completed a strategic growth investment in Behavioral Health Works (BHW), a behavioural health services provider specialising in therapy and ancillary services for children with autism spectrum disorder and related disorders. Financial terms of the transaction have not been disclosed.    Established in 2009, BHW works with families, schools and other professionals to offer comprehensive therapy services based on the principles of Applied Behavioural Analysis (ABA).
